GH4099 is a typical aging strengthened nickel based high-temperature alloy, which is comprehensively strengthened with elements such as Co, W, Al, Ti, etc., giving the alloy high thermal strength. It can be used for a long time below 900 ℃, and the highest working temperature can reach 1000 ℃. Due to its stable microstructure and satisfactory cold and hot forming and welding process performance, GH4099 high-temperature alloy is very suitable for manufacturing high-temperature plate load-bearing welding structures such as aviation engine combustion chambers and afterburner chambers.

GH3230 is a solid solution strengthened high-temperature alloy with W and Mo as the main strengthening elements. GH3230 alloy mainly improves its oxidation resistance by adding Cr element to the alloy, while adding trace elements to assist in improving the alloy’s oxidation resistance. Therefore, the alloy has good strength, thermal stability, and oxidation resistance. GH3230 alloy can be used to manufacture combustion chambers, flame tubes, heat exchangers, and other components of aviation turbine engines. It can also be used to manufacture combustion chamber components of ground gas turbines and high-temperature equipment components such as thermocouple protective sleeves and flame baffles for industrial furnaces.

GH5188 is a solid solution strengthened cobalt based high-temperature alloy, which is strengthened by adding 14% tungsten to give the alloy excellent high-temperature thermal strength. At the same time, adding a high content of chromium and trace amounts of La gives the alloy good high-temperature oxidation resistance. Compared to nickel based high-temperature alloys, GH5188 has more good creep resistance, thermal corrosion resistance, fatigue resistance, and high temperature strength. GH5188 has excellent formability, welding and other process properties, making it suitable for manufacturing parts for aircraft engines that require high strength below 980 ℃ and anti-oxidation below 1000 ℃. In the 1980s, GH5188 alloy was applied to components such as vortex plates and flame deflectors in turboshaft eight aircraft engines. Currently, some aircraft engines use GH5188 alloy sheets to prepare high-temperature components such as combustion chamber walls, outer walls, and sealing plates.

GH4169 is an aging precipitation strengthened alloy with γ~Ni as the matrix, γ ” phase (Ni3Nb) as the main phase, and weak strengthening phase γ ‘[Ni3 (Al, Ti)] with a face centered cubic structure. It has excellent high-temperature strength, oxidation resistance, corrosion resistance, fatigue resistance, and good high-temperature creep strength. It is commonly used in the manufacture of hot end structural components and is widely used in aerospace, energy, military and other fields.
